Through this research paper, we will try to know how government policies, individuals, and school education are cooperating for the holistic development of a special child in India. Through this paper, we will also know who the special children are and why they require extra care. By the way, most people know that any child whose brain is not developed in time, or dumb and deaf children, blind children, etc., comes in the category of special children. Earlier, these children were seen as inferior in society, and even childless children were a burden for their parents in life. But, as time passed, the government of India made many plans for the development of these children, and society also fully supported them, so that these children are now a part of society and live like a common man. These children grow up, get jobs, and start their own businesses. And this has been possible only through schemes of Govt. of India and special education.
